, QUESTION 1

Mr. C testifies in court about the theft of his car. During cross-examination the
defense alleges that Mr. C is lying. The prosecutor accordingly calls Mr. W to come
and testify that Mr. C had earlier told him the same thing. Mr. W’s evidence is....

1. opinion evidence.
2. hearsay evidence.
3. circumstantial evidence.
4. evidence about a previous consistent statement.



QUESTION 2

Consider the following statements regarding marital privilege and choose the correct
option:

1. A third party that overhears a conversation between two spouses cannot
testify about that communication in a court of law.
2. Marital privilege applies to communications made during the marriage. If the
spouses get divorced, that privilege will no longer apply to communications
made during the marriage.
3. During a domestic violence dispute, a husband points a gun at his wife
and verbalises his intention to kill her and the children. In a following
criminal case, the wife can be compelled to testify about the pointing of
the gun but can refuse to testify about what the husband said to her
during the dispute.
4. Marital privilege belongs to the party who made a specific communication.
